When should you adjust your mirrors?

Explanation:
Your seating position sets the baseline for everything you see around you. Adjust the seat first so you can reach the pedals, sit comfortably, and have a good view over the dashboard. Only after you’re in that driving position should you adjust the mirrors. The angle of the mirrors depends on where you’re sitting, so if you fix the mirrors first and then move the seat, the view can shift and create blind spots. So, set the seat, then tune each mirror to give you a clear view of the lanes next to you and the rear area. This order helps ensure you’re seeing accurately from your own position, which is key to spotting hazards and staying safe.
